Abstract

This study aims to identify and inventory of  potentially pathogenic species of parasites cause disease in ornamental fish, both caught in the Lais lake and the domestication activities. Beside is to know  The relationship between water quality with a prevalence, intensity and dominance of parasites that attack ornamental fish in domestication.  The reseach activities were conducted since  January 20, 2010 until March 16, 2010.  The fish samples collected from the fishermen  were identificated   and  inventoried by means of recording of parasite type, amount and organs  attack the fish using the identification book (Kabata, 1985) and the identification key of parasite by Bykhovskaya, et al. (1964) and calculated the value of prevalence, intensity and domination. The results showed four parasitic protozoan species were  Myxobolus sp, Glossatella sp, Vorticella sp., Chilodonella sp. and one species of non-protozoan  (worms) was  Dactylogyrus sp. in Lais lakes and in the  domestication. The parameter of water quality  such as  temperature, DO, pH and NH3  have  relationship to total of  parasites, parasite prevalence and intensity of attacks.   The value range of water quality parameters of  Lais lake where  temperature 27.68 0C-28 730C, DO 3.00-5.98 mg/L, pH 5.19-5.84 and NH3 0.01-0.02 mg/L.  The value range of  water quality of domestication activities were   temperature 27.83 0C-28.51 0C, DO 5.38-6.38 mg/L, pH range on average from 5.60-6.41 and ammonia (NH3) average ranged from 0.02-0.01 mg/L.  The above range values  showed  the optimum range of water quality for fish and they support for the health of fish.
